Perceptual mechanism-throughputs of the perceptual process
What is the meaning of Perceptual mechanism or throughputs of the perceptual procedure? Briefly describe it.
Expert
The customary stimuli or inputs are processed via selection, organization and interpretation. Although all the individuals go via this procedure, they vary in how they choose, systematize and interpret stimuli based on their personality, pre-disposition and the biases.
